WebbThe recovery of small colony variants (SCVs) from clinical specimens was first described at the beginning of the last century. However, not until the past decade was an association of these variants with chronic, recurrent, and persistent infections such as chronic osteomyelitis and persistent skin and softtissue infection described. Webb15 feb. 2024 · There are four key findings on x-ray that suggest a diagnosis of rheumatoid arthritis: Reduced joint space - generally symmetric. Articular surface erosions: discontinuities in the bone plate. Periarticular osteopaenia: hypodensity of bone surrounding the joint. Soft tissue swelling.
